ARQ Simulation Tool
- Login to Download
- 1 Credits
Resource Overview
Detailed Documentation
This tool is fundamentally engineered for ARQ simulation environments, with particular strength in modeling stop-and-wait ARQ protocols. The implementation typically involves state machine logic to handle packet transmission, acknowledgment reception, and timeout mechanisms. Key functions would include packet sequencing, error detection through CRC checksums, and retransmission handlers. The protocol simulation helps analyze critical performance metrics like throughput efficiency and latency characteristics under various channel conditions. Furthermore, the tool features API integration capabilities allowing seamless combination with other simulation frameworks such as network simulators or channel modeling tools. This interoperability enables researchers to construct comprehensive communication system models that can simulate complex scenarios including variable packet sizes, different error rates, and multiple node interactions. The tool's modular architecture supports protocol extensions through customizable callback functions for packet processing and event handling, making it an essential resource for communication systems research and development.
- Login to Download
- 1 Credits